Applications of PTI, PPPP candidates for vote recount rejected
By Our Correspondent
July 30, 2018
BAHAWALPUR: Recounting of votes applications of the PTI candidates for PP-245 Muhammad Asghar Joiya, who is also the district president of PTI Bahawalpur and PP-241 Malik Muzaffar Awan also party’s Bahawalnagar district president, had been rejected by their respective returning officers. Both the candidates had been defeated by the PML-N candidates Malik Zaheer Iqbal Channar and Kashif Mehmood. Earlier the application for the recounting of votes of the PPPP candidate for NA-174 Makhdoom Hassan Gilani was rejected by the returning officer in Ahmadpur East.
